🕵️Murder Mystery Night – Can You Solve the Crime? 🔎
A vibrant evening of intrigue, deception, and deduction as you join us for an unforgettable Murder Mystery Experience. You’ll be plunged into a gripping storyline brought to life by a team of professional actors, who will perform scenes, drop clues, and answer your team’s questions—if you know the right ones to ask.
As the mystery unfolds, teams will work together to follow a paper trail of secrets, red herrings, and hidden motives. With each twist and turn, you'll get closer to the truth… or further from it.
By the end of the evening, only the sharpest minds will piece together the Method, Motive, and Murderer. But be warned: everyone had something to gain from the victim’s downfall, and nothing is ever as it seems.
